1. Pair with a Fitted Top

Pair with a Fitted Top

Photo Credit: silkfred.com

For a balanced look, you can wear a tulle skirt, provided it is the right style for your body, with a top that is either fitted or cut close to the body. This type of top helps to show off the waist area quite well, and the tulle skirt will add the flow and drama to the bottom if it’s voluminous. To enrich the silhouette in a better way, tuck the top into the skirt; besides, for more grace, choose a high-waisted tulle skirt.

3. Add a Silk Blouse

Silk Blouse

Photo Credit: ca.slipintosoft.com

If you were to wear a tulle skirt with a silk blouse, the combination would make you look classy and upscale. The smoothness of the silk fabric is a fitting contrast to the tulle skirt since they are both lightweight and refine but give that ‘princess’ vibe. On a formal occasion, do not miss this nice outfit; it would be a must for a formal dinner, wedding, or any special event.

5. Layer with a Denim Jacket

Denim Jacket

Photo Credit: whitneyswonderland.com

A denim jacket will lend some tough glam to the tulle skirt and create a strong contrast between the roughness of the denim and the softness of the tulle. Why not wear this ensemble at a more laid-back event, or when you want to add casualness to your skirt which is the more formal type?

6. Pair with a Sweater

Sweater

Photo Credit: shopltk.com

Adding a cozy sweater to a tulle skirt combines the childlike elements of the skirt with a sense of elegance. Whether you choose a bulky or an elongated knit top, this pairing would be perfect for winter and autumn evenings, keeping you from the cold and looking well at the same time.

11. Layer with a Blazer

 Blazer

Photo Credit: ellaprettyblog.com

To give your tulle skirt some more structured and composed aura, you should put a blazer on. The blazer’s clear lines make a good contrast with the playful quality of the skirt, making it a piece of dressier but still-formal attire or suitable for most smart-casual gatherings.
